dar*_*rgy 0 java sql ms-access
我正在使用sql.java进行工作,只要执行此查询,它就会给我标题中提到的错误
try(PreparedStatement statement = conn.prepareStatement("INSERT INTO student_signup(q" + strId + ")" + "WHERE student_email="+email+"VALUES(?)")) {
statement.setString(1, SelectedOption);
statement.executeUpdate();
statement.close();
Run Code Online (Sandbox Code Playgroud)
这里有一些代码背景
int questionID=1;
String strId = Integer.toString(questionID);
String email = signInForm.getTxtEmail().getText();
Run Code Online (Sandbox Code Playgroud)
INSERT插入新行。我认为您想更改现有行中的值。为此,请使用UPDATE。像这样:
UPDATE student_signup
SET strID = ?
WHERE student_email = ?;
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
60 次 |
| 最近记录: |